Transaction 95585bfe3e68b7961eb89776f8945b3b06cc9b2afcd90bbeb3417db750e3360d
1 Input
2 Outputs
- 95585bfe3e68b7961eb89776f8945b3b06cc9b2afcd90bbeb3417db750e3360d:0
- 95585bfe3e68b7961eb89776f8945b3b06cc9b2afcd90bbeb3417db750e3360d:1
value 20012330264
address 1K9RqunSAa853gmgZkY5zcg41uiqPFgTiD
value 15000000000
address 3Pcxs7MixsFMBRFYnjuy5JCiCqdjV5BjS6